How do I handle timezone issues in MySQL?
To handle timezone issues in MySQL, you can set the timezone for your session or globally using the SET time_zone
command.
What if my application is in UTC but the database is in a different timezone?
You can convert the time to UTC before storing it in the database and convert it back to the desired timezone when retrieving it.
How can I check the current timezone setting in MySQL?
You can check the current timezone setting by running the query SELECT @@global.time_zone, @@session.time_zone;
.
Are there any best practices for managing timezones in MySQL?
Yes, it's best to store all timestamps in UTC and convert them to local time only when displaying to users.
